05/20/2008 - Paris, France (Sportsbook Betting Lines) - Three-time Grand Slam champion Lindsay Davenport pulled out of the 2008 French Open on Tuesday, citing personal reasons.
The 31-year-old former world No. 1 star has won every major event, with the exception of the French Open, where she reached the semifinals back in 1998 to mark her best-ever showing in Paris.
The currently 26th-ranked Davenport returned to the WTA Tour last September after taking an 11-month hiatus to start a family.
Roland Garros 2008 will commence Sunday.
